Chair Based Exercise
Our Chair-Based Exercise classes aim to improve flexibility and fitness
for people who prefer to remain seated, either on a chair or in a wheelchair.
The classes are gentle and are particularly suitable for people who are
less able. They offer the opportunity to exercise to music and to improve
your limb mobility, muscle strength, co-ordination, balance and range
of movement.
The classes are set to lively music and use simple equipment such as
balls, bands and hoops.
What is the class like?
The class starts with a gentle warm up, followed by exercises that work
all parts of the body in turn, and you will be encouraged to work at your
own pace and rest if you need to. Even your hands and feet will get a
work out! The class lasts 45 minutes.
At the end of the class you will cool down and then we hope that you
will stay for a cup of coffee or tea and a chat.
